obavještavamo vas da je dana 15.12.2005. u dvorani Hahn edukacijskog centra KBC Zagreb održan inicijalni sastanak sekcije Mladih specijalista i specijalizanata psihijatrije Hrvatske (Young Psychiatrist = svi specijalizanti i specijalisti do dobi od 40 godina).
Sekcija je osnovana kao dio Hrvatskog psihijatrijskog društva, pod pokroviteljstvom predsjednika HPA, prof. dr.sc.Lj. Hotujca.

Sekcije mladih psihijatara djeluju kao dio World Psychiatric Association (WPA) u sklopu programa ”Institutional Program to Promote the Professional Development of Young Psychiatrist” u mnogim zemljama diljem svijeta s razgranatom mrežom stručne i znanstvene suradnje.
Ciljevi sekcija su promicanje aktivnosti mladih psihijatara, osobito edukacije, znanstvenih i stručnih skupova, znanstvenih publikacija, razvoja komunikacijske mreže među mladim psihijatrima te identifikacije i rješavanje specifičnih problema iste skupine, odnosno afirmacija mladih psihijatra.
Na ovaj način uključujemo se u svjetsku mrežu znanstvene i stručne suradnje s ciljem unaprijeđivanja naših znanja i vještina.

Cilj inicijalnog sastanka bio je uključiti što veći broj specijalizanata i mladih specijalista na razini Hrvatske u izradu plana i programa rada sekcije te potaktnuti aktivno sudjelovanje svih novih članova u daljnjem radu sekcije.
Izabrani su korespodenti za pojedine regije diljem Lijepe Naše koji imaju za cilj obavijestiti mlade psihijatre i specijalizante o osnutku ove sekcije.

WPA Young Psychiatrists Network constitutes an assembly of all young psychiatrists within the umbrella of WPA. Its components include the WPA Young Psychiatrists Council (YPC) (composed of the young psychiatrists officially representing WPA Member Societies), all Fellows from current and past WPA Congresses, the members of the WPA Educational Liaison Networks of Young Psychiatrists and Psychiatrists in Training, and all young psychiatrist members of WPA Member Societies.

WPA YOUNG PSYCHIATRISTS COUNCIL IS ESTABLISHED

The Executive Committee (EC) of the World Psychiatric Association (WPA), at its meeting in Vienna, June 2003, established a WPA Young Psychiatrists Council (WPA-YPC) within the framework of the WPA Institutional Program to Promote the Professional Development of Young Psychiatrists (WPA-IPYP). Young psychiatrists in this context include psychiatrists in training and those less than 40 years of age or practicing less than five years since completion of residency training.

Background
· In August 1999 the WPA General Assembly established the WPA-IPYP as an expression of top institutional commitment to the future of our field.
· Since then, the IPYP has undertaken a number of activities such as the organization of Fellowships at WPA World and International Congresses and of awards to stimulate scientific contributions from young psychiatrists.
· The evaluation of recent Fellowship Programs revealed that the Fellows attributed high value to good interrelationships among themselves and expressed their wish to maintain close connections to WPA.
· Many WPA Member Societies have expressed interest in promoting the professional development of their young members and in being centrally involved in WPA initiatives concerning young psychiatrists.
· It may be noted that WPA already has two networks involving young psychiatrists. One is the Educational Liaison Network of Young Psychiatrists and Psychiatrists in Training, which has been operational since 1996. The other is the WPA Congress Fellows Network, which has been operational since the World Congress in Hamburg in 1999. Together, these networks incorporate over 350 young colleagues, all of whom receive periodic institutional information.
· Additionally of relevance, WPA has young psychiatrists within its regular individual membership (they automatically become members in WPA through their Member Societies) and within its special individual membership (for which there is an application form and dues payable, the level of which may be adjusted for young psychiatrists).

The WPA Young Psychiatrists Council (WPA-YPC)
· This body is composed of young psychiatrist representatives appointed for a non-renewable period of up to three years (a WPA triennium between World Congresses of Psychiatry) by Member Societies (one per Society). This reflects the importance of building this new development on the structure of Member Societies (currently 123), which are the main bases of WPA. The appointment of a representative will be made by the Member Society’s executive committee in consultation with available committees on training and young psychiatrists. An appointment form is enclosed.
· Members societies will be asked to appoint their corresponding representatives as soon as possible. The inaugural period of the WPA-YPC will be 2003-2005 and its composition will be renovated after the Cairo World Congress.

· The WPA-YPC will enjoy autonomy to carry out its functions and develop initiatives, within the supportive framework of the WPA-IPYP and in accordance to the Statutes, By-Laws, Manual of Procedures and ethical standards of WPA.
· The objectives of the WPA-YPC are the following:
a. To improve communication between the WPA Member Societies and WPA governance (Executive Committee and Zonal Representatives) concerning young psychiatrists
b. To identify and address problems involving young psychiatrists within the framework of standard organizational analysis (internal strengths and weaknesses and external opportunities and threats)
c. To promote the participation of young psychiatrists in the various sectorial activities of WPA (education, sections, meetings and publications).
d. To encourage Member Societies to recognize and address the needs of young psychiatrists, develop special activities for them and incorporate them into pertinent structures such as training and executive committees. The WPA leadership will be asked to collaborate with the WPA-YPC in this regard.
e. To contribute to the designing of other initiatives to promote the professional development of young psychiatrists.
· The leadership of the WPA-YPC will consist of one elected leader from each of the four WPA Regions (Americas, Europe, Africa & Middle East and Asia & Australia). Each regional leader will be elected by the Council representatives appointed by the Member Societies in the Region (with elections organized by the WPA-IPYP through e-mail or other reasonable means). The period of office for a regional leader will be the WPA triennium between World Congresses of Psychiatry. The WPA-YPC leadership will be invited to participate as observers in WPA General Assemblies, for which mechanisms of institutional support will be explored.
· Meetings of the WPA-YPC will be organized periodically at WPA International and World Congresses.

WPA-IPYP Networks, Communicational Mechanisms and Linkages
· Sustained efforts will be undertaken to upgrade existing young psychiatrists’ networks, i.e. those of the WPA Congress Fellows and of the WPA Educational Network.
· A WPA-Young Psychiatrists Intranet will be established by the WPA and the YPC in collaboration with the Education Coordination Center in order to foster communication among WPA-related young psychiatrists.
· Collaborative linkages will be considered with organizations having goals and activities consistent with those of WPA.

Colophon The establishment of the WPA Young Psychiatrists Council, to be implemented immediately, and the enhancement of related developments represent a major new effort of WPA towards the fulfillment of its commitment to promote the future of our field.

I am pleased to write to inform you of a major new initiative of the World Psychiatric Association: The establishment of the World Psychiatric Association Young Psychiatrist Council (WPA-YPC) is part of our efforts to promote the professional development of our younger colleagues who, as we all recognize, represent the future of our field.

The WPA-YPC will be composed of young psychiatrist representatives of WPA member societies (one per society). The purpose of this Council is to represent young psychiatrists across the world under the framework of the WPA and its member societies, and to optimize efforts to foster their professional development. The WPA Institutional Program on Young Psychiatrists will be directly involved in working with the new WPA-YPC that is being established. More information on the Council’s purpose and working procedures is contained in the attached statement.

To implement this WPA-YPC initiative, I would appreciate the that executive committee of your society, in consultation with any committees on training and young psychiatrists you may have, appoint a young psychiatrist (under 40 years of age) to this Council as soon as possible, using the appointment form attached, and sending along a one-page biographical sketch of the appointee. The appointment will be valid for the triennium September 2002 to September 2005.
